#e1a353 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e1a353 is composed of 88.2% red, 63.9%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.6% magenta, 63.1%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 33.8 degrees, a saturation of 70.3% and a lightness of 60.4%. #e1a353 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a6 with #c34700.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#e1a353 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e1a353 has RGB values of R:225, G:163,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.63,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14787411.
